iPhone 3G Confirmed - Gizmodo is saying that they have confirmed the long running rumor that on June 9th Apple will announce the new model at the WWDC keynote and available shortly there after worldwide.

US Currency Unfair - A federal appeals court said that the current one size for all bills is unfair to the blind and it should be changed in some fashion to accommodate them. For many countries that means size changes since texture differences can often to worn out on bills. A solution that meets the courts ruling is probably years away.

Charter Opt-Out Doesn't Really Opt-Out - Charter's recent decision to track its customers internet activity for the purposes of directed advertising supposedly comes with a complicated opt out option. The thing is the option only opts you out of the targeted advertising; it doesn't stop them from tracking your internet activity. Which of course means all your private activity is available to the corporation (and its employees) to use, sell, or do with as they see fit (say turn over to the government). This could also be in violation of the Cable TV Privacy Act but it will take someone with money to litigate that.

Top 10 Miyamoto Games - Shigeru Miyamoto is probably the father of the modern video game with pretty much every game out there having an influence from his work. The list just features what Gamepro thinks as his best, not sure if I agree:
10) Donkey Kong (1981)
9) Sar Fox (1993)
8) Metroid Prime (2002)
7) Nintendogs (2005)
6) Super Mario Galaxy (2007)
5) Legend of Zelda: Wind Waker (2003)
4) Wii Sports (2006)
3) Super Mario 64 (1996)
2) Legend of Zelda: A Link to the Past (1992)
1) Super Mario Bros 3 (1990)
